KORG_Read_pcg

Reading the .pcg-fileformat for KORG synths

GitHub GitHub release (latest by date) Github All Releases Follow

Reads files in .pcg-format; many Synths from KORGs e.g. the Triton line of synths can store and load these files, for sharing sound data between different synths like Triton, Triton LE, Karma, Triton Extreme, X50 etc. However some are not capable of loading samples, just sound settings, due to the lack of sample ram memory and sampling feature. .pcg-files can be found e.g. in the download-section of korgforums.com http://www.korgforums.com/downloads.htm

I started this project around July 2009 after i bought my very portable X50-Synth. It is just a tiny sample project. Maybe it can not read every pcg-file, but it could serve as a starting point for your own implementations, or maybe just in case you want to see whats inside this or that pcg-file.

Click File->Open (e.g. "Yamaha Guitar\GUITAR.PCG") or maybe just drag'n'drop a pcg-file from windows explorer onto TR-Reader. TR-Reader tries to read the file, please be patient for a second or two. In the textbox it shows some informations about the read chunks. Now click "View->Show Samples" and you can step through the samples (.KSF) in the Listbox on the left (if there are any). On the right click the button "Wave" in menu File click "Save All wav" (please be patient) now if you click the "Play"-button you can audition the samples (if there are any).
